#0e1c0e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0e1c0e is composed of 5.5% red, 11%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 50% cyan, 0% magenta, 50% yellow and 89% black. It has a hue angle of 120 degrees, a saturation of 33.3% and a lightness of 8.2%. #0e1c0e color hex could be obtained by blending #1c381c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003300.

#0e1c0e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#0e1c0e has RGB values of R:14, G:28, B:14 and CMYK values of C:0.5, M:0, Y:0.5, K:0.89. Its decimal value is 924686.
